What to Look For in an SEO Marketing Company
The best seo company will assist your business in improving its ranking on Google so that it can bring in more customers and increase sales. This is achieved through using a variety of strategies to enhance the performance of your website. This includes link construction, content marketing and social media.
Choose an SEO agency with a high rate of client retention. This means that the agency is in constant communication with its clients and is able to deliver results.
Expertise
Search engine optimization (SEO) also referred to as search engine marketing, is a service which focuses on improving your business's online visibility. They use strategic processes to boost your page's rankings and increase traffic and sales. They are also adept at creating a strategy for your brand and generating relevant links to help build an audience.
Choose an SEO firm that will focus on the specific goals of your business and will offer you customized proposals. This will let you evaluate the costs and deliverables of your most preferred candidates. The best agencies will also explain their strategies, and the reasons they suggest certain strategies. They will also make sure your website meets all SEO criteria.
The best way to identify an established SEO marketing firm is to review their portfolios. These are cases studies of their previous work, and they'll demonstrate how their clients have benefited from their businesses through SEO. Also, look out for companies that have blogs and social media accounts. This is a sign that they stay up to date with the most recent SEO trends.

Find an agency with an array of experts. The team should consist of managers and strategists, and teams that specialize on different tasks. This will guarantee that your campaign will be successful.
In addition to having a range of experts, the top SEO companies will have years of experience. Their knowledge and expertise will allow them to provide your company with the highest quality results. They will also be able to adjust to any changes Google might make.
NP Digital, a leading SEO company, offers a wide range of services that include keyword research, link building, and on-page optimization. Their clients range from small-scale businesses to large brands. Their management team has more than five decades of hands-on experience in the development of solid SEO strategies.
OuterBox is an SEO and performance company that focuses primarily on ecommerce brands. They use a unique approach to marketing that incorporates SEO, PPC, and content marketing. They also make use of a variety of sources to build links, including HARO local citations and press releases redistribution. They are also Google Premier Partners, and Yelp Certified Specialists.
Experience
A reputable SEO firm will boost your website's traffic. This will result in more sales and leads for your business. They will also improve the conversion rate of your site. They will employ a variety of techniques to achieve this, such as keyword research, on page optimization, link building and content strategy.
Before you choose an SEO agency, ask for case studies and testimonials. These will allow you to assess the company's level of expertise and success. In addition, the company should have experts on staff who are proficient in a variety of online marketing strategies.
You should also request a written proposal from the most qualified candidates. It should include details on pricing, timelines, and deliverables. Then, you can compare the proposals to determine which is most suitable. If the agency provides a free consultation, then it is worth taking the time to meet them in person.
The best SEO agencies will have an account manager who will manage all aspects of your campaign. This will save you a lot of time and headaches. In addition, they'll give you reports on the development of your campaign and help you understand how to make your website more search engine friendly.
It is crucial to remember that your company's needs may change over time when choosing an SEO agency. A reliable agency is flexible and able to adapt to your needs. They will also consider your bigger goals when developing the strategy. For instance, if are planning to expand into a new area, your SEO agency will incorporate this goal into the overall strategy.
If you are considering hiring an SEO agency or not, it's crucial to know the benefits of digital marketing. SEO can be an effective way to bring visitors to your website and increase sales. It can also boost the visibility of your brand and increase its credibility. Utilizing the appropriate keywords and relevant content can increase your rank on Google's search results page.
The most effective SEO companies can increase your ROI and provide tangible results. They have the experience to get you onto the first page of Google search results. They will also provide various services, such as managing social media, web design, and PPC advertising.
Transparency
Transparency is a crucial factor in SEO, and it's important to choose an SEO agency that is open with its clients. This will ensure that both the customer and the agency are aware of what's happening. It also builds trust with search engines. A transparent SEO agency will also be open to discussing any concerns or issues.
Transparent SEO practices involve avoiding black hat techniques, such as buying links and using high-quality content on websites. They also include optimizing website speed and mobile-friendliness. These methods help companies gain the trust of their audience and increase their search engine rankings. They also avoid penalties, which can damage a company's reputation with its audience and search engines.
A legitimate SEO firm will provide a comprehensive list of the services and costs associated with each campaign. This includes keyword research, competitor analysis, and website audits. They should also explain their strategies and give a timeline of results. This will help you determine whether they are a suitable fit for your company.
As a prospective customer, you should also inquire of your prospective SEO partner for references from previous clients. These reviews will provide you with a better understanding of their work and how they've assisted other companies. In addition you can browse their social media profiles to see how they interact with their followers. This will give you a good idea of their knowledge and how they treat their customers.
It's also an excellent idea to look into an SEO company that has a solid brand. This will help them stand out and you can decide if they are the right fit for your brand. A value proposition and buyer personas are a great way to build a strong SEO brand. This will help you to identify your ideal audience and identify their pain points and needs. Then, you can adapt your strategy to meet these needs.
A transparent SEO agency will keep you informed of their performance and progress. They will also be transparent about their results and may even recommend a different approach. It is important to remember that SEO is a lengthy process, and you might not see results for months.
Invoices
A well-organized and consistent system of quoting and billing is an essential part of SEO services. A consistent and professional quoting and invoicing system is a critical component of SEO services. It also makes your appearance more professional to your customers and they will notice.
SEO (Search Engine Optimization) A complex process, involving a number of factors that impact your website's position on search engine result pages. These include keywords research, quality of content as well as link building and other online marketing activities. The ultimate goal is to boost your rank in search results and to drive visitors to your site. However this can be costly, particularly for small-sized businesses with limited budgets.
A reputable SEO firm can increase your online visibility by utilizing the most effective techniques and tools. This includes making use of social media and paid advertisements to get your website in front of more potential customers. They will also provide an in-depth review of their work, and provide suggestions for improvements to the website. A reputable SEO company will be able to describe how your website is ranked on the search engines and how that impacts your business.
Kosmo is an online invoicing program that allows you to create and send invoices. You can create invoices using a variety of customizable options that match your branding, and include important details like taxes and payment terms. You can automate reminders to notify clients know when their payments are due.
Another way to improve your process of invoicing is by incorporating a payment processing feature to your invoices. This will allow your customers to pay directly through the platform and save you time and money on managing invoices manually.
Online invoicing is a fantastic tool to simplify business processes and boost the efficiency of your business. Invoicing software online can help you make your billing process more efficient and help you save money on printing costs and shipping costs. In addition, you can easily integrate these tools with your existing systems. This will help your employees to complete the task and allow you to concentrate on your business's core.